Output 6b5ac7bef7d5ab64d461e9ebb2d1bc9fe795ded13525379b2d2cac5fe8875ae4:5

value
89836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a102c0b86e4801527ba64f4c70924e61c86e6c OP_EQUAL
address
39gMbTR6ms2UTuF7iWSSFiDLZtygzhSF3j
transaction
6b5ac7bef7d5ab64d461e9ebb2d1bc9fe795ded13525379b2d2cac5fe8875ae4
confirmations
60030
spent
true